| Feature | COSORI | Ninja |
|---|---|---|
| Cooking Technology | TurboBlaze fan speeds up to 3600 rpm for crispy results | Standard convection technology with less emphasis on fan speed |
| Control Interface | Digital with app connectivity | Manual dials or basic digital controls |
| Temperature Range | 90°–450°F | Typically up to 400°F |
| Cooking Modes | 9-in-1 multi-function | Multiple modes but fewer options |
| Size | 6 Qt capacity | Varies, often 4-5 Qt |
| Smart Features | Yes, app control and recipes | No, basic controls |
| Design | Modern, sleek, cream finish | Varies, often black or stainless |
| Price Range | Mid to high | Moderate |

Deeper Analysis of Features
The TurboBlaze technology in the COSORI air fryer provides a higher fan speed, which helps achieve crisper textures compared to many Ninja models. Its 9-in-1 versatility covers most cooking needs, from roasting to proofing bread, making it a true all-in-one appliance. Ninja air fryers tend to focus on straightforward, reliable performance with fewer modes, which appeals to users who prefer simplicity and quick results.
